  • Title

    Waiting time estimation with pre-specified accuracy in a single-server queueing system

  • Abstract
    This paper contains results on the development of accurate methods for the mean value estimation for a stochastic process with statistically dependent outcomes. Firstly, the regenerative method is explained, and then. a new method, based on the expression for the sample size as a function of the accuracy of estimation, is developed and explained. In contrast to the regenerative method, which estimates the confidence interval for the defined confidence level and a constant sample size, the proposed method and techniques estimate the mean value with the pre-specified accuracy and with a variable sample size.
